Sidewall bubble/tire pressure on RS7
Recently had to get a tire replaced on my RS7 (21" rims) due to a sidewall bubble. On a hunch i checked the tire pressures via the MMI and they were 49 psi all around. I thought i read somewhere that overinflation can make bubbles more common.
Anyway...what are you RS7 fellas with factory 21s running pressure wise? if im reading the manual and door jamb sticker correctly, its 45/45 max load and 41/38 normal load.
Also, i assume id have to store the new settings if i lowered my pressure all around??
